This New Moon of the Sixth Month was the final period of the Sixth Ascents of Moses at Sinai as we detailed in the paper Ascents of Moses (No. 070).
“On the year of the Exodus, the Day of Pentecost fell on Sunday 6 Sivan. The period between 1 and 6 Sivan was spent in preparing Israel to receive the Law of God. Moses ascended the Mountain of God six times.

The ascents and descents were from the Book of Exodus:

Ascent             Number           Descent
19:3-6              First                19:7-8
19:8-13            Second           19:14-19
19:20-24          Third                19:25
24:9-32:14       Fourth              32:15-30
32:31-33          Fifth                32:34-34:3
34:4-28            Sixth               34:29-35

Ascents one, two and three were in the first six days of Sivan, prior to the fourth ascent.

The fourth ascent was after Pentecost towards the end of Sivan, and went for forty days until the end of Tammuz.”

It was in this month that Ezra and Nehemiah finished construction of the wall at Jerusalem. They began work on the wall in the Fifth month on the second or third day of the month and work was completed in fifty-two days on the Twenty-fifth day of the Sixth month, Elul. In other words, it was constructed from the days after the New Moon of Ab to the end of the month of Elul, and for the New Moon of the Day of Trumpets. The timing is examined in the paper Reading the Law with Ezra and Nehemiah (No. 250). “
